ForgeFix achieves new and revised quality accreditation

ForgeFix has received independent, third party recognition of its quality-focused approach.

The business - which is one of the UK's leading distributors of fixings, fasteners, power tool accessories and hardware - has retained its ISO 9001 certified status and met the revised requirements set out by the new 2015 version of the globally recognised quality management standard.

ForgeFix initially achieved ISO 9001:2008 certification in August 2015 following a rigorous and robust audit of its quality management systems across a range of areas - including staff competence and training, customer satisfaction and resource planning.

The requirements of ISO 9001 were subsequently revised in September 2015 in-line with a regular five yearly review of the scheme's compliance criteria in order to ensure continued relevance. 

The most recent changes take into account the challenges and opportunities faced by organisations in an ever-evolving world.

In particular, they focus on aspects such as increased globalization, a greater need for risk-based thinking and the growing use of multiple management systems simultaneously.

All organisations certified to ISO 9001:2008 must transition to the new 2015 version by midnight on the 14th September 2018 after which a certificate to ISO 9001:2008 will no longer be valid.

ForgeFix took the decision to upgrade its certification early because of its progressive approach and its confidence in its existing quality management systems being ‘ahead of the curve'.

The external audits required by ForgeFix to demonstrate its compliance with ISO 9001:2008 and ISO 9001:2015 were both conducted by TÜV UK - a UKAS (United Kingdom Accreditation Service) accredited certification body that offers independent third party assessments.
